Mass. Gen. Laws (Crim. Proc.) § 278:28A: Appellate division of superior court for review of sentences
What this law says, in plain English
This statute establishes an appellate division of superior court to review criminal sentences to state prison and certain reformatory sentences, defines its composition and jurisdiction, and specifies clerk duties.
